The Science-Backed Brushing Technique
The American Dental Association (ADA) emphasizes three non-negotiables for effective brushing:
- 45-degree angle bristles toward gums
- 2-minute duration
- All surfaces coverage (front, back, chewing)
The video’s “Top to bottom, every line” chant aligns perfectly with ADA guidelines. Here’s how to execute it:
Step-by-Step Breakdown
Front teeth first (0:00-0:10)
- Use short back-and-forth strokes while singing "Left to right, side to side"
- Parent tip: Hold the brush with them to demonstrate gentle pressure
Molars matter (0:20-0:30)
- Circular motions on chewing surfaces as lyrics cue "Round and round"
- Common pitfall: 80% of cavities start here. Spend extra time
Gumline cleanup (0:45-1:00)
- Angle bristles at 45° and sing "Swish, swish, swish" while sweeping away plaque
- Critical reminder: Avoid aggressive scrubbing to prevent recession

Brushing Games That Prevent Cavities
Unmentioned in the video but proven effective: turn brushing into play with these dentist-approved hacks:
Engagement Boosters
| Game | How to Play | Benefit |
|---|---|---|
| Sticker Race | Add a sticker to a chart per successful brush | Builds consistency |
| Character Rescue | “Save” teeth from “sugar bugs” with brushing | Teaches cavity prevention |
| 2-minute DJ | Let child pick a favorite song | Ensures full duration |
